ClubDJ Pro vs The Ultimate Piano

Side-by-side comparison to help you choose the right tool.

ClubDJ Pro is a versatile DJ software with built-in dual-deck video mixing, offering GPU effects and shader transitions for a professional experience.

Last updated: March 19, 2026

The Ultimate Piano offers realistic online piano practice with MIDI support, interactive learning tools, and instant.

Last updated: March 4, 2026

Visual Comparison

ClubDJ Pro

ClubDJ Pro screenshot

The Ultimate Piano

The Ultimate Piano screenshot

Feature Comparison

ClubDJ Pro

Dual Deck Video Mixing

ClubDJ Pro features innovative dual-deck video mixing, allowing DJs to synchronize and blend video content alongside their audio tracks. With 25+ GPU-accelerated video effects and over 41 shader transitions, users can seamlessly create a captivating visual experience that enhances their performances without the need for additional plugins.

Auto BPM & Beat Sync

This software incorporates advanced beat detection technology that provides 2-decimal precision for Auto BPM detection. The continuous phase-locked sync ensures that tracks remain perfectly aligned, making it effortless for DJs to maintain a consistent beat throughout their set, whether performing live or practicing.

Vinyl Scratching

ClubDJ Pro supports true vinyl scratching, offering a realistic experience with its low-latency audio engine. This feature supports bidirectional playback and frequency sliding, delivering a natural feel that is crucial for DJs who want to replicate the classic vinyl scratching technique in a digital format.

Live Waveforms

The software provides live waveform visualization, which displays scrolling waveforms along with beat grid overlays. This feature allows DJs to easily identify drops, breaks, and beat positions at a glance, facilitating more precise mixing and enhancing the overall performance.

The Ultimate Piano

Play Piano Online

Play directly in your web browser without the need for any software installation. The Ultimate Piano supports mouse and computer keyboard inputs, as well as connections to MIDI keyboards. With beautiful, realistic piano samples, every note you play comes to life.

MIDI Player & Falling Notes

Load any MIDI file and watch the notes illuminate on the keyboard in real-time as they play. The MIDI Player allows users to slow down the tempo, navigate note by note, or loop specific sections, making it easier to master challenging passages.

Chord Detection & Learning

As you play, The Ultimate Piano recognizes and displays the chord names in real-time. This feature enhances your understanding of harmonic relationships, allowing for a more intuitive and free playing experience while learning.

Learning Modes

The platform offers interactive support for learning chords and scales. Users can select specific scales, such as the "Blues Scale in Ab," and the system will visualize and play it on the keyboard. The Scale Trainer further assists with detailed performance analysis.

Use Cases

ClubDJ Pro

Live Performances

ClubDJ Pro is ideal for live performances, enabling DJs to mix audio and video tracks in real-time. The dual-deck functionality and synchronized visuals create an engaging atmosphere for audiences, allowing DJs to showcase their skills and enhance the overall experience.

Practice Sessions

DJs can use ClubDJ Pro for practice sessions, benefiting from features like waveform visualization, looping, and beat matching to hone their skills. This environment allows them to experiment with different tracks and techniques in a user-friendly setting.

Video DJing

With its built-in video mixing capabilities, ClubDJ Pro is perfect for video DJs looking to integrate visual content into their sets. The extensive library of GPU-accelerated effects and transitions allows for creative expression and dynamic performances that captivate audiences.

Mobile DJing

ClubDJ Pro’s compatibility with iOS devices makes it an excellent choice for mobile DJs who need a lightweight, portable solution. Whether at a wedding, party, or corporate event, DJs can easily mix tracks from their iPhone or iPad, making it a versatile tool for on-the-go mixing.

The Ultimate Piano

Practice for Beginners

New pianists can use The Ultimate Piano to familiarize themselves with basic chords and scales. The interactive features help beginners build confidence and develop a strong foundation in music theory.

Advanced Skill Development

Experienced musicians can utilize the platform to refine their techniques and explore complex musical concepts. The MIDI Player and chord detection features allow for targeted practice and deeper understanding of music.

Music Theory Education

Teachers can leverage The Ultimate Piano as a teaching aid, showcasing various scales and chords in real-time. This interactive tool provides a visual representation of music theory, making it easier for students to grasp difficult concepts.

Fun Learning for Kids

With the Kids Mode feature, children can learn piano in a fun and engaging way. The adorable animal icons associated with each note help young learners connect with music, making practice an enjoyable experience.

Overview

About ClubDJ Pro

ClubDJ Pro is a sophisticated DJ software application designed for both amateur and professional DJs, offering a seamless experience for mixing tracks in real-time. Launched in 2004 and revitalized with cutting-edge technology, it is compatible across multiple platforms including iOS, macOS, and Windows. This versatility allows DJs to perform from virtually any device, making it an essential tool for mobile and stationary setups alike. The software boasts a user-friendly, performance-oriented interface that prioritizes speed and simplicity, ensuring that DJs can focus on their mixes without being bogged down by unnecessary complexity. With features like dual decks, waveform visualization, cue points, looping, beat matching, pitch control, and real-time effects, ClubDJ Pro provides all the essential tools that DJs have come to expect from high-quality DJ software. Built by an independent developer, the application is continuously evolving to meet the needs of the music mixing community, empowering users to unleash their creativity and elevate their live performances.

About The Ultimate Piano

The Ultimate Piano is a cutting-edge, browser-based tool specifically designed for pianists and music learners seeking to improve their skills without the burden of downloading software. This versatile platform caters to a wide audience, from beginners embarking on their musical journey to advanced musicians looking to refine their techniques. Users can effortlessly connect MIDI keyboards or utilize their computer keyboards to practice piano anytime and anywhere. The Ultimate Piano offers a multitude of features, including real-time chord detection, a diverse scale trainer with 14 different scale types, and an ear training module that sharpens auditory skills for recognizing intervals and chords. Additionally, the platform includes a chord explorer to deepen users' understanding of music theory. With the capability to load MIDI files, visualize falling notes, and practice alongside audio or YouTube videos, The Ultimate Piano delivers an interactive, engaging learning experience. Its user-friendly interface ensures that all musicians have the tools they need to practice effectively and grasp music theory concepts with ease.

Frequently Asked Questions

ClubDJ Pro FAQ

What platforms is ClubDJ Pro available on?

ClubDJ Pro is available on multiple platforms including iOS, macOS, and Windows. This cross-platform compatibility allows DJs to mix music from virtually any device.

Is there a subscription fee for ClubDJ Pro?

No, ClubDJ Pro operates on a one-time purchase model. After the initial purchase, users have access to all features without the need for a subscription.

Can I try ClubDJ Pro before purchasing?

Yes, ClubDJ Pro offers a free mixer version that can be accessed online without any downloads required. This allows users to test the software's features before committing to a purchase.

What makes ClubDJ Pro unique compared to other DJ software?

ClubDJ Pro stands out due to its built-in dual-deck video mixing capabilities, extensive GPU-accelerated video effects, and no-subscription pricing model. It is specifically designed to provide a streamlined and efficient mixing experience without overwhelming users with unnecessary features.

The Ultimate Piano FAQ

Do I need to install anything to use Ultimate Piano?

No, The Ultimate Piano is a browser-based tool, meaning you can practice piano online without the need for any installations. Simply access the platform through your web browser.

Can I connect my MIDI keyboard?

Yes, you can connect your MIDI keyboard to The Ultimate Piano. This allows for a more authentic playing experience, enabling you to practice with real piano sounds and features.

What chords and scales can I learn?

The Ultimate Piano offers a comprehensive range of chords and scales, including 14 different scale types. Users can explore various options and visualize them in real-time as they practice.

Does Ultimate Piano have ear training?

Yes, The Ultimate Piano includes an ear training module designed to help users develop their auditory skills for recognizing intervals and chords, enhancing their overall musical proficiency.

Alternatives

ClubDJ Pro Alternatives

ClubDJ Pro is a professional DJ mixing software that caters to DJs across various platforms, including iOS, macOS, and Windows. This application provides essential tools for real-time track mixing, making it suitable for both beginners and seasoned professionals. Users often seek alternatives to ClubDJ Pro due to factors like pricing, specific feature requirements, or compatibility with their preferred operating systems. When searching for an alternative, it's crucial to consider the software's performance capabilities, user interface, and the range of features offered. Look for options that prioritize speed and efficiency while also providing the essential mixing tools necessary for creating seamless transitions and engaging performances.

The Ultimate Piano Alternatives

The Ultimate Piano is an innovative browser-based tool designed for pianists and music learners, offering realistic sounds, MIDI support, and interactive learning tools. As a comprehensive platform in the Audio & Music and Education & Learning categories, it provides users with a unique opportunity to practice piano skills without the need for software downloads. Users often seek alternatives to The Ultimate Piano for various reasons, including pricing considerations, specific feature sets, and compatibility with different platforms. When searching for an alternative, it is essential to evaluate factors such as ease of use, range of features, support for MIDI devices, and the overall quality of the learning experience to ensure the chosen tool effectively meets individual needs and preferences.

Continue exploring